Transaction 08394a35590620e78683a3cbd3838d9b85999877d94d83f787eaf1a93a479e7f
1 Input
1 Output
-
08394a35590620e78683a3cbd3838d9b85999877d94d83f787eaf1a93a479e7f:0
- value
- 913338
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3dfa80159d3ccba04419d4f0d0417e292c1406af OP_EQUAL
- address
- 37LjEK8idRF48yh4tEoLDXx3XjZoXX3ojf